Does anybody know in what situation "Maximum packet size exceeded in a
request" from _sess_read() in snmp_api.c could happen? Is following
related?
Here is what I found,
msgMaxSize is set different between udp and tcp. Is it supposed to be
the same?
For tcp (in both snmplib/snmpTCPDomain.c and snmplib/snmpTCPDomain.c),
it sets
t->msgMaxSize = 0x7fffffff;
For udp (snmplib/snmpUDPDomain.c)
t->msgMaxSize = 0xffff - 8 - 20;
For udp (snmplib/snmpUDPIPv6Domain.c)
t->msgMaxSize = 0xffff - 8 - 40;
For unix (snmplib/snmpUnixDomain.c)
t->msgMaxSize = 0x7fffffff;
